Orquestación de Plataforma

**Descripción:** La orquestación de plataforma en el contexto de PaaS (Platform as a Service) se refiere a la disposición, coordinación y gestión automatizadas de sistemas y servicios informáticos complejos. Este enfoque permite a los desarrolladores y empresas gestionar aplicaciones y servicios en la nube de manera eficiente, facilitando la integración de diferentes componentes y la automatización de procesos. La orquestación se centra en la interconexión de servicios, la gestión de recursos y la optimización del rendimiento, lo que resulta en una infraestructura más ágil y escalable. Las características principales incluyen la capacidad de automatizar tareas repetitivas, la integración de múltiples servicios y la gestión de flujos de trabajo, lo que permite a las organizaciones centrarse en el desarrollo de aplicaciones en lugar de en la infraestructura subyacente. La orquestación de plataforma es esencial en entornos de microservicios, donde múltiples servicios independientes deben comunicarse y trabajar juntos de manera coherente. En resumen, la orquestación de plataforma es una herramienta clave para maximizar la eficiencia y la efectividad en el desarrollo y la gestión de aplicaciones en la nube.

**Historia:** La orquestación de plataformas ha evolucionado a lo largo de los años con el crecimiento de la computación en la nube. En la década de 2000, con la llegada de los servicios de nube pública, surgieron herramientas de orquestación para gestionar la infraestructura y los servicios de manera más eficiente. A medida que las arquitecturas de microservicios se hicieron populares, la necesidad de una orquestación más sofisticada se volvió evidente, llevando al desarrollo de soluciones como Kubernetes en 2014, que revolucionó la forma en que se gestionan los contenedores y los servicios en la nube.

**Usos:** La orquestación de plataformas se utiliza principalmente en el desarrollo y gestión de aplicaciones en la nube, permitiendo a las empresas automatizar el despliegue, la escalabilidad y la gestión de servicios. También se aplica en la integración de sistemas heterogéneos, facilitando la comunicación entre diferentes aplicaciones y servicios. Además, es fundamental en entornos de microservicios, donde se requiere una coordinación eficiente entre múltiples servicios independientes.

**Ejemplos:** Ejemplos de orquestación de plataformas incluyen el uso de Kubernetes para gestionar contenedores en aplicaciones distribuidas, así como herramientas como Apache Mesos y Docker Swarm, que permiten la orquestación de servicios en entornos de microservicios. También se pueden mencionar plataformas como AWS Elastic Beanstalk y Google App Engine, que ofrecen capacidades de orquestación integradas para facilitar el desarrollo y la gestión de aplicaciones en la nube.

  • Rating:
  • 0

Deja tu comentario

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*

PATROCINADORES

Glosarix en tu dispositivo

instalar
×
Enable Notifications Ok No